With a distinguished 20-year tenure at 糖心原创, including a decade as its 10th president, Dr. Larry L. Cockrum serves as President-Emeritus, where he focuses on strategic projects to advance the university鈥檚 growth and innovation. 

During his presidency, the university experienced unprecedented growth, expanded access to education, and strengthened its financial foundation. A dedicated advocate for affordability, Dr. Cockrum launched the 糖心原创 Commitment, which reduced on-campus tuition by 57 percent, and the One Price Promise, which provided free textbooks for all students. His leadership also helped eliminate long-term debt, increase funding for student scholarships, and significantly grow the university鈥檚 endowment.

As Vice President for Academic Affairs, Dr. Cockrum led the development of the university鈥檚 first online programs, including Kentucky鈥檚 first fully online master鈥檚 program for teachers. This expansion played a critical role in making 糖心原创 a national leader in educational accessibility, with enrollment growing to over 24,000 students.

Throughout his tenure, Dr. Cockrum prioritized student success, employee stability, and institutional sustainability. His legacy reflects a profound commitment to innovation, student-centered focus, and meaningful impact across the university community.

Before joining 糖心原创, he served as Dean of Administration, Dean of Students, and Executive Director of the Keeter Center for Character Education at College of the Ozarks.

Dr. Cockrum holds a bachelor鈥檚 degree in science education from College of the Ozarks, a master鈥檚 degree in science education from Missouri State 糖心原创, a doctorate in higher education administration from Vanderbilt 糖心原创, and a post-graduate certificate from Harvard 糖心原创.
